Title: printer setup (driver download)
Post by: John Alamo on July 05, 2003, 09:36:06 PM
Hi .. I recently setup my 5.6 box for print services. Both printers function fine, however, I am having trouble setting up the server to auto-download drivers.

I followed the steps at http://www.netadmintools.com/part258.html for "Point and Print in Samba", however, when I get to the point of installing the driver, I get the following error:

"The file '*.inf' on Windows 2000 Server CD-ROM is needed."

I am unable to go any further.

Setup Info -->

W2kPro client logged in as admin

smb.conf modified to add the following in [print$]:

write list = @admin

smb.conf modified to add the following in [print$] and [printers]:

printer admin = @admin

All other steps followed the "Point and Print in Samba" How-To.

Any suggestions/advise would be greatly appreciated!

PS --> I noticed print queue management stuff does not work as well (ie pause queue, delete job, etc from Windows) -- should this work or do I need to login to e-smith and use the lpr commands?
